Overview
The Accounting programme at Western Kentucky University offers a comprehensive curriculum designed to prepare students for the complexities of the modern financial landscape. By combining technical proficiency with critical thinking, the university ensures graduates are ready for careers in public accounting, corporate finance, and auditing.
Students benefit from a student-centred approach that emphasises engagement and professional success. The curriculum is innovative and adapts to the shifting demands of the industry, incorporating data analytics and communication skills. Small class sizes in upper-level courses allow for personalised instruction and meaningful interaction with expert faculty members.
The department maintains high standards of academic excellence, evidenced by its prestigious AACSB accreditation.
Why Accounting at Western Kentucky University?
Graduates from this institution consistently achieve some of the highest CPA exam pass rates in the region, including Kentucky, Indiana, and Ohio. The Gordon Ford College of Business provides state-of-the-art facilities and a culture of mentorship that supports students from their first semester through to graduation.
The university offers a unique Joint Undergraduate Master's Program (JUMP), which allows high-achieving students to earn both their bachelor's and master's degrees concurrently within five years. Additionally, the programme provides extensive support through career coaching, mock interviews, and networking events with industry professionals.
Distinctive teaching features include an applied learning experience where over 60% of senior students gain career-related experience before finishing their studies. Students also have access to study abroad opportunities and global learning experiences that broaden their professional perspective and cultural understanding.

Careers with Accounting
Graduates are well-equipped for a variety of roles across diverse sectors, including finance, healthcare, government, and technology. Common career paths include public accounting, corporate finance, auditing, and tax consultancy. The programme's focus on technical competency and data analytics ensures graduates are competitive in the job market.
The skills acquired allow for significant career flexibility, with many alumni moving into leadership positions or specialised roles as Certified Public Accountants. The university's strong links with the business community and dedicated career services help students transition smoothly into professional employment within international and governmental agencies.

Other requirements
General requirements
- A completed application (open WKU application for admission)
- Minimum academic requirements: Freshmen: 2.5 GPA / Transfer:* 2.0 GPA
- *Students with 24 or more earned hours of college credit
- English proficiency requirements
- $75 non-refundable application fee
- Official Academic Records from schools attended with grades and any degrees/diplomas/certificates received. Should also include a literal English translation.
- Financial Evidence of Support must be provided to obtain an I-20
- Students transferring from within the US will need to fill out the Transfer-In Form
